Thunderbird makes an audible noise but nothing appears in the Inbox.

WoodenHorse

I’ve set up two email servers on Thunderbird. I’ve imported all my old Outlook emails, which uses a POP email server, to Thunderbird. When I send a new message to the ‘Outlook’ email server Thunderbird makes an audible noise but nothing appears in the Inbox. If I click on the Get Messages pull-down and select the server it then downloads the messages. Is it possible to set Thunderbird up so that it does this automatically? Also is possible to set Thunderbird up so that it downloads all messages from all servers by just clicking Get Messages?

In account settings, in the server settings area, you can select how often to check for new messages.

Many thanks for the reply but that is not the problem I have. Messages are automatically downloaded from the 'working' mail server but not the other server. The only way to download from that server is to use the Get Messages pull-down menu.
